_lwp_wakeup man page on NetBSD

Man page or keyword search:  
man Server   9087 pages
apropos Keyword Search (all sections)
Output format
NetBSD logo
[printable version]

_LWP_WAKEUP(2)		    BSD System Calls Manual		_LWP_WAKEUP(2)

NAME
     _lwp_wakeup — make a blocked light-weight process runnable

LIBRARY
     Standard C Library (libc, -lc)

SYNOPSIS
     #include <lwp.h>

     int
     _lwp_wakeup(lwpid_t lwp);

DESCRIPTION
     _lwp_wakeup() makes a blocked LWP runnable.  The blocked LWP must be in
     LSSLEEP state.  Unblocking the LWP does not guarantee that it will make
     progress; it may block again as soon as it resumes execution in the ker‐
     nel.

RETURN VALUES
     Upon successful completion, _lwp_wakeup() returns a value of 0.  Other‐
     wise, an error code is returned to indicate the error.

ERRORS
     _lwp_wakeup() will fail if:

     [ESRCH]   No LWP can be found in the current process corresponding to
	       that specified by lwp.

     [ENODEV]  The specified LWP is not in LSSLEEP state.

     [EBUSY]   The specified LWP is blocked in an uninterruptible sleep.

HISTORY
     The _lwp_wakeup() system call first appeared in NetBSD 2.0.

BSD			       January 13, 2003				   BSD
[top]
                             _         _         _ 
                            | |       | |       | |     
                            | |       | |       | |     
                         __ | | __ __ | | __ __ | | __  
                         \ \| |/ / \ \| |/ / \ \| |/ /  
                          \ \ / /   \ \ / /   \ \ / /   
                           \   /     \   /     \   /    
                            \_/       \_/       \_/ 
More information is available in HTML format for server NetBSD

List of man pages available for NetBSD

Copyright (c) for man pages and the logo by the respective OS vendor.

For those who want to learn more, the polarhome community provides shell access and support.

[legal] [privacy] [GNU] [policy] [cookies] [netiquette] [sponsors] [FAQ]
Tweet
Polarhome, production since 1999.
Member of Polarhome portal.
Based on Fawad Halim's script.
....................................................................
Vote for polarhome
Free Shell Accounts :: the biggest list on the net